摘要:,,本文探讨了区块链开发技术的前沿探索。随着区块链技术的不断发展,开发者们正致力于优化和完善这一领域的各个方面。文章介绍了最新的区块链技术趋势,包括智能合约的优化、分布式应用的升级、隐私保护的强化等。还讨论了区块链技术在供应链管理、金融、医疗等领域的应用前景。区块链开发技术的前沿探索正不断推动这一领域的创新和发展。
随着信息技术的飞速发展,区块链技术已成为全球关注的焦点,作为一种分布式数据库技术,区块链以其不可篡改、去中心化的特性,在金融、物联网、供应链管理等领域展现出巨大潜力,本文将深入探讨区块链开发技术的关键要点,带您领略这一领域的魅力与前景。
主体:
区块链技术概述
区块链是一种基于去中心化、分布式账本技术的数据库系统,其核心特性包括数据不可篡改、共识机制、智能合约等,随着技术的不断进步,区块链的应用场景越来越广泛,如数字货币、供应链溯源、物联网等。
区块链开发技术要点
1、区块链架构:了解公有链、私有链和联盟链的架构特点,为开发选择合适的架构奠定基础。
2、共识机制:熟悉PoW、PoS、DPoS等共识算法的原理和实现方式,确保系统的安全性和效率。
3、智能合约:学习Solidity、Vyper等智能合约编程语言,实现复杂业务逻辑。
4、加密技术:掌握哈希算法、公私钥加密等技术,确保数据安全。
区块链开发实践
1、跨链技术:研究如何实现不同区块链之间的互操作性,提高系统的扩展性。
2、隐私保护:探讨如何在保障数据隐私的同时,实现区块链的透明性和安全性。
3、性能优化:研究如何提高区块链系统的交易速度、存储效率和可扩展性。
4、实际应用案例:分析金融、供应链、物联网等领域的成功案例,为开发提供借鉴。
区块链开发的前景与挑战
随着区块链技术的不断成熟,其应用领域将越来越广泛,区块链开发将面临以下机遇与挑战:
1、跨界融合:区块链将与人工智能、物联网、云计算等技术相结合,创造更多应用场景。
2、法规政策:关注各国政府对区块链的监管政策,确保开发的合规性。
3、技术创新:持续创新是区块链发展的关键,需要不断研究新技术、新应用。
4、人才培养:区块链领域的人才需求巨大,培养专业人才是推动区块链发展的重要任务。
本文详细介绍了区块链开发技术的关键要点,包括技术概述、开发要点、实践应用以及前景与挑战,区块链技术的潜力巨大,未来将在更多领域得到应用,作为开发者,我们需要不断学习和掌握新技术,为区块链领域的发展做出贡献,关注法规政策、人才培养等方面的问题,共同推动区块链技术的成熟与发展。
我们期待区块链技术在金融、供应链、物联网等领域创造更多价值,为人类社会带来更多便利,让我们携手共进,共同探索区块链开发技术的未来!
区块链开发技术正处于快速发展阶段,掌握其核心要点对于开发者来说至关重要,希望通过本文的介绍,读者能对区块链开发技术有更深入的了解,并在实践中不断探索和创新。